Anaerobic Injection Water Preparation
KB-1® Primer is used to prepare anaerobic water to disperse electron donors and protect anaerobic cultures during bioaugmentation injections into aquifers. Prior to KB-1® Primer, production of anaerobic water was time consuming, often produced water with solids that required filtration and had pH impacts. KB-1® Primer is an easy to use and time efficient product to facilitate anaerobic conditions during remediation injections.
SiREM specializes in the growth of microbial cultures that promote dechlorination of chlorinated solvents and mineralization of benzene. These cultures are strictly anaerobic, which can present challenges when large volumes of electron donor and amendments are to be injected with aerobic water, and/or the aquifer is non-reducing. At SiREM our primary focus is helping our clients inject our culture in the safest and most effective way possible. SiREM’s KB-1® Primer product produces reducing conditions in a timely manner and does not adversely impact SiREM’s bioaugmentation culture activity or viability.

Anaerobic injection water prepared with KB-1® Primer meets the following criteria:
- ORP less than -75 mV
- pH between 6 and 8
- Provides the conditions to maintain healthy microbial populations
